Natural Ingredients

From
Source to
Shelf

Everything in Cake Lab's product is natural. The coloring, the ingredients, the process. Instead of stating this broadly, we make it specific and personal. A short portrait-format piece where Cake Lab speaks directly about a key ingredient or technique, how they discovered it, what makes it difficult to work with, and why they chose it anyway. That specificity is what builds genuine trust.

Brand VoiceNaturalFounder Story

The Full Picture

Packaging, Process and Proof

Packaging-led cut that carries the viewer from the finished product back to the craft behind it.

Step 01 The Craft Behind the scenes of the making. The techniques, the precision, and the details that most brands never take the time to show.
Step 02 Packaging The textured boxes and thoughtful presentation used as part of the story, not just a container. Content that makes the unboxing as desirable as what is inside.
Step 03 Customer Satisfaction The moment of first taste. Closing the loop from craft all the way to the person it was made for and showing the full journey on camera.
Talent Strategy UGC and KRTN Talent

KRTN models and directed influencer content bring a genuine customer-side perspective to the campaign. Real faces and authentic reactions as a marketing strategy that actually converts rather than just gets views.

Partnership Model Barter Collabs

KRTN arranges partnerships with prominent food creators and influencers in the UAE and wider region. Creators receive Cake Lab product in exchange for authentic, organic content. No cash outlay required from the brand. Credible reach through people their audience already trusts.
